Understanding NEET: Exam Structure and Scoring Method

To evaluate any NEET coaching institute, it is necessary to understand the exam itself.

NEET UG Exam Overview:

Component

Details

Mode

Offline (Pen & Paper)

Subjects

Physics, Chemistry, Biology

Questions

180 (MCQ-based)

Total Marks

720

Negative Marking

Yes (-1 per incorrect answer)


Subject Weightage:

Subject

No. of Questions

Marks

Physics

45

180

Chemistry

45

180

Biology

90

360

Success in NEET depends heavily on Biology accuracy, Physics problem-solving ability, and conceptual Chemistry, making subject-specialised instruction critical.
